Sec.  515.329  Person subject to the jurisdiction of the United States.



    The term person subject to the jurisdiction of the United States 

includes:

    (a) Any individual, wherever located, who is a citizen or resident 

of the United States;

    (b) Any person within the United States as defined in Sec.  515.330;

    (c) Any corporation, partnership, association, or other organization 

organized under the laws of the United States or of any State, 

territory, possession, or district of the United States; and

    (d) Any corporation, partnership, association, or other 

organization, wherever organized or doing business, that is owned or 

controlled by persons specified in paragraphs (a) or (c) of this 

section.]
